Inventor: Lou Schwartz , Valérie Maquil , Thibaud Latour , Annie Guerriero , Séverine Mignon
IPC: G06F3/03
Abstract: A system comprising an object; a computer device with a digital model containing a virtual object corresponding to the object; a position sensor for detecting the position of the object; and a communication means to transmit the position of the object to the computer device. The object is stretchable and the system is further provided with sensors for detecting the stretched condition of the object and with communication means to transmit said condition to the computer device. A system with actuators to modify the position and/or the stretched condition of the object and use of such systems for a collaborative complex problem-solving procedure in the context of urban planning.

Inventor: Thomas URIOS , Patrick CHOQUET , Sergey ERSHOV
Abstract: A coated steel substrate coated with a first coating including above 40 wt. % of chromium and optionally one or several elements chosen from yttrium, silicon, calcium, titanium, zirconium, vanadium, niobium and nickel in an amount below 10 wt. % for each element, the balance being chromium and a second coating including from 2 to 30 wt. % of Aluminum, from 10 to 40 wt. % of chromium and optionally one or several elements chosen from yttrium, silicon, calcium, titanium, zirconium, vanadium, niobium and nickel in an amount below 10 wt. % for each element, the balance being iron, the steel substrate including Cr≤2.0% by weight; a method for the manufacture of this coated steel substrate; a method for the manufacture of a coated hot steel product; a coated hot steel product and the use of a hot steel product.

Inventor: Christelle ANDRE , Joelle LECLERCQ , Claire BEAUFAY , Lucy CATTEAU , Sylvain LEGAY
IPC: A61K31/215 , A61K31/19 , A61P33/02 , C12P15/00
Abstract: The present invention relates to a method for the production of a (poly)hydroxylated pentacyclic triterpene composition including a 3-O-p-coumaroyl ester of tormentic acid from a plant suspension cell culture, to a pharmaceutical composition comprising at least 3-O-p-coumaroyl ester of tormentic acid for a use in the prevention and/or the treatment of trypanosomiasis, optionally in admixture with other (poly)hydroxylated pentacyclic triterpenes, and to 3-O-p-coumaroyl ester of tormentic acid for its use as an antiparasitic agent for the prevention and/or the treatment of trypanosomiasis, optionally in admixture with other (poly)hydroxylated pentacyclic triterpenes.

Inventor: Nicolas Godard , Daniele Sette , Sebastjan Glinsek , Emmanuel Defay
IPC: C09D11/52 , B41J2/175 , B41M5/00 , C09D11/322 , C09D11/38
Abstract: An inkjet-printing-base process for depositing functional materials, for example PZT, on a substrate, in various instances platinized silicon. Substrate templating (via SAMs) and material deposition are both performed by an inkjet printing process. Additionally, a composition to be used as a SAM precursor ink which is a thiol in a solvent mixture, wherein the composition can be 1 dodecanethiol in a solvent mixture of 2-methoxyethanol and glycerol.

Inventor: Xavier Mestdagh , Lionel L'Hoste , Nicolas Tytgat
IPC: A01K61/90
Abstract: An apparatus for producing ventral images of aquatic organisms, such as amphibians, for example, of newts the apparatus comprising a hollow conduct and a watertight container. The hollow conduct has a first opening and a second opening being opposed from each other. The hollow conduct and the watertight container are separated by a wall which transmits the wavelengths comprised between 390 nm and 1.4 μm. The apparatus is opaque to the wavelengths comprised between 390 nm and 1.4 μm. The watertight container comprises an underwater video camera oriented towards the wall. The apparatus is remarkable in that the watertight container is positioned below the hollow conduct, the watertight container being filled with clean water. Additionally, a method for detecting, identifying and/or individualizing aquatic animals.

Inventor: François BARNICH , Nuria MARTINEZ-CARRERAS , Jean-François IFFLY , Oliver O'NAGY
Abstract: An automatic water sampler apparatus which comprises at least one movable injection unit that can be positioned in order to inject the sample in a specific vial disposed on a tray of the apparatus, the tray being on the base of the apparatus. The positioning is done by two positioning units. The input unit of the apparatus comprises at least one water collector, but can also comprise four or more water collectors. The invention is also directed to a method of sampling water from a predetermined water body, where a plurality of samples can be collected thanks to the automatic water sampler apparatus.

Inventor: Mathieu GERARD , Jérôme POLESEL MARIS
Abstract: An electric generator comprising a rotor with permanent magnets, configured for rotating about a rotation axis; at least one magnetic yoke with at least two arms extending axially inside or outside of the rotor so as to be adjacent to the radial inner or outer side, respectively, of the rotor; wherein the permanent magnets are arranged according to an Halbach array so as to maximize the magnetic field on the radial side of the rotor adjacent to the arms of the at least one yoke. Also, a valve for gas cylinder, equipped with a corresponding electric generator.

Inventor: Nicolas BOSCHER , Jean-Baptiste CHEMIN
Abstract: A method for forming an electrically conductive multi-layer coating with anti-corrosion properties and with a thickness comprised between 1 μm and 10 μm onto a metallic substrate, comprising the following subsequent steps of (a) providing a solvent-free suspension consisting of solid electrically conductive fillers dispersed into a liquid matrix forming material that contains vinyl groups; (b) depositing the suspension on at least a surface portion of a metallic substrate; (c) exposing an atmospheric pressure plasma to the surface portion so as to form one electrically conductive layer with anti-corrosion properties; and (d) repeating the steps (a), (b) and (c). The method is remarkable in that the electrically conductive fillers are electrically conductive carbon-based particles.

Inventor: Didier Ari , Damien Lenoble , Mouhamadou Moustapha Sarr
IPC: C09C1/30 , C01B32/16 , H01B1/20 , H01B1/04 , B82Y30/00 , B82Y40/00 , B60C1/00 , C01B32/162 , C08J3/20 , C08L9/06 , C08L33/12 , C23C16/26
Abstract: A composite material comprising at least one polymer matrix. The polymer matrix comprises at least one inorganic load composed of a biphasic material that comprises at least one mesoporous substrate at least partially coated with carbon nanotubes. The composite material is remarkable in that the mesoporous substrate is composed of diatoms.

Inventor: Thomas Schleeh
Abstract: The invention is directed to a three-dimensional polymer network for encapsulating a pharmaceutical ingredient, the polymer network comprising (a) at least one first polymer; and (b) at least one cross-linking agent. The three-dimensional polymer network is remarkable in that the at least one first polymer comprises a first polyuronate derivative, the first polyuronate derivative being modified with a hydrophobic moiety; and in that the at least one cross-linking agent is calcium chloride and/or a cyclodextrin derivative.
